The short version

Fairfax County is significantly wealthier than the US average, with a median household income of $127,866. Population has grown 19% since 2000. 62%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, well above the national rate of 33%. Median home value has more than doubled since 2000, reaching $576,700. Poverty is rare here, at 5.9% of residents. Households here earn about 67% more than the Virginia median.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Fairfax County, Virginia?

Fairfax County, Virginia has about 1,150,309 residents according to the 2020 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Fairfax County, Virginia?

The typical household in Fairfax County, Virginia earns about $127,866 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Fairfax County, Virginia expensive?

In Fairfax County, Virginia, the median home is worth about $576,700, and the typical rent is about $1,898 a month.

How educated are people in Fairfax County, Virginia?

About 62.1% of adults age 25 and over in Fairfax County, Virginia h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Fairfax County, Virginia?

About 5.9% of people in Fairfax County, Virginia live below the federal poverty line.

Has Fairfax County, Virginia grown since 1990?

Yes, Fairfax County, Virginia has grown since 1990. The population has added about 331,725 residents, a change of about 41 percent over that period.
